French Open – Oscar Otte complains of hate messages and death threats: “There are no exceptions”

The number of messages depends primarily on the opponent. “If I lose against a lower-ranked player, up to 50 messages come,” reported Otte, who played his opening match at this year’s French Open against Spaniard Roberto Carballes Baena on Tuesday.

Meanwhile, Otte fondly remembers Paris. In 2019, the Rhinelander had lost in three sets against star player Roger Federer from Switzerland in the second round, but “that was one of the coolest days of my career so far,” said Otte.
